Brendon Urie was not a brave man.

Dallon knew that. Why else would he be so skeptical when an invitation to a “dangerous mission” arrived at his doorstep? However, he ultimately set doubt aside, donning a badge and becoming the group’s Detective.

Brendon Urie was not a brave man.

Ryan Ross understood that better than anyone-there was a reason they hadn’t spoken in months. Yet, he still felt hopeful when that invitation arrived, putting on a 70’s style hot pink button up and becoming the group’s Troublemaker.

Brendon Urie was not a brave man.

While they hadn’t known each other for long, Jon still knew that to some extent. But if Ryan had decided to go, he supposed he would too. Dressing up in a stylish green coat, he became the group’s Record Producer.

Brendon Urie was not a brave man.

Spencer knew that, but for whatever reason, he couldn’t help but trust him. Therefore, with a swift nod, he accepted the invitation, putting on a red, white, and blue outfit and becoming the group’s Daredevil.

Neither of the Way brothers knew Brendon as well as some of the others who had been invited. And so they blindly accepted, the prospect of an adventure exciting them. Mikey threw on a pair of aviators, Gerard a yellow beret, and they became the group’s Investigative Reporter and Jetsetter, respectively.

Pete didn’t really take Brendon’s cowardice into account, taking the invitation as another reason to hang out with friends. That’s why he gladly changed into the most 70’s outfit he could find in his closet, and became the group’s Super Spy.

Patrick had always valued both Brendon and Pete as creatives, and so he decided to join them both, putting on a yellow, orange, and gold flowery ensemble and becoming the group’s Hippie.

Ryan Seaman only knew Brendon through stories, but he thought he seemed nice enough. And so, he put on a fluffy purple coat and became the group’s Disco Dancer.

With everyone’s roles and fates decided, the friends that Brendon so kindly invited gathered at the coordinates provided, ready to save the town of Everlock.
